The Beginnings of Coffee
The specific beginnings of coffee are shrouded in tale, but it is believed to have originated in Ethiopia. According to folklore, a goatherd named Kaldi observed that his goats came to be extra energised after eating coffee cherries. This exploration led to the growing and consumption of coffee as a stimulating drink.

Coffee Beans: A Worldwide Asset
Coffee beans are the seeds of the coffee plant, which comes from the Rubiaceae family members. There are two main species of coffee plants: Coffea arabica and Coffea robusta. Arabica beans are normally taken into consideration to generate a smoother, much more flavorful cup of coffee, while robusta beans are understood for their higher high levels of caffeine web content and stronger flavor.

Coffee is expanded in different areas worldwide, each with its one-of-a-kind environment and dirt conditions that add to the distinctive taste accounts of the beans. A few of the most distinguished coffee-producing nations consist of Brazil, Colombia, Vietnam, Indonesia, and Ethiopia.

The Roasting Process
Roasting is a essential action in changing raw coffee beans into the tasty product we enjoy. Throughout toasting, the beans are warmed in a drum roaster, causing them to transform color and create a range of tastes. The roasting procedure can vary from light to dark, with lighter roasts preserving more level of acidity and sweet taste, while darker roasts have a more intense, smoky flavor.

Brewing Techniques: A World of Opportunities
The brewing approach can dramatically influence the taste and fragrance of your coffee. Several of one of the most popular developing approaches consist of:

Coffee: A concentrated coffee drink made forcibly hot water via carefully ground coffee beans under high pressure.
Pour-over: A manual coffee roasters brewing approach that involves putting hot water over coffee premises in a filter.
French Press: A plunger-style technique that steeps coffee premises in hot water prior to pressing the bettor to separate the grounds from the made coffee.
Cold Mixture: A technique that entails soaking coffee grounds in cold water for an extended time period, leading to a smooth, much less acidic taste.
